Abstract
Accessibility of regional traffic in the worst-hit areas of Sichuan should be viewed with some concern. The difficulty of disaster relief work in May 12th Earthquake had showed unsubstantial traffic condition of the disaster area. Approach of weighted average travel time is adopted in this paper to calculate accessibility of 3 main traffic manners, i.e. highway, railway and aviation, and their integrative accessibility in 36 counties of the area, relation between integrative accessibility and regional economy development are analyzed, and suggestions are presented for reconstruction of traffic network in the area after the disaster. It is indicated that highway has the best accessibility, aviation takes second place, while railway takes the worst. Accessibility of each manner presents increase by degrees from the central city Chengdu to peripheral counties, consistent with distribution of main lines of traffic, and has logarithm relation with level of regional economy development. In order to harmonize the relation between accessibility and regional economy development, accessibility of marginal area should be enhanced with emphasis in the reconstruction after the disaster.
